Job Description

Job Summary:


Provides variety of ambulatory behavioral health services including evaluation, diagnosis, treatment planning, medication management, case management, and psychotherapeutic intervention to individuals, families, groups and/or Intensive Outpatient Programs. Provides services to adults of all ages, adolescents, and children as within the scope and licensure/certification.


Essential Responsibilities:


  • As a credentialed and privileged provider, in collaboration with physicians and other behavioral health providers, manages care for patients with behavioral health conditions including assessment, evaluation, education & development of individualized plan of care including medication management. Reviews and establishes diagnoses. Orders and monitors diagnostic tests, performs procedures as within the scope of practice.
  • Utilizing the latest Diagnostic and Statistical manual of Mental Disorders (DSM) and International Statistical Classification of Disease and Related Health Problems (ICD) for diagnostic references. Be familiar and utilizes a wide range of the latest evidenced based interventions and modalities.
  • Provides psychotherapy and counseling for individuals, families, groups and/or Intensive Outpatient Programs. Utilizes a wide range of intervention modalities, which support positive mental health and enhanced individual or family functioning. Provides services such as medication management, crisis intervention, brief therapy, individual, group and family therapy. Interviews member and evaluates their psychological and mental status. Refers members in need of immediate or urgent care to appropriate level of services, within time frame established by policy. Collaborates with physicians, primary care staff, and other interdisciplinary clinical team members involved with assessment and care of patient. Follows program description in area of specialty as applicable.
  • Researches, collects, and records data and information relating to identification and treatment of behavioral and interpersonal problems of patient. Formulates treatment plan for these conditions. Assists to establish clinical best practices and guidelines for delivery of service to population of patients served.
  • Documents clinical assessments, treatment plans, interventions, and other relevant information in patient medical record according to regional and departmental guidelines. Maintains confidentiality of all patient information and records in accordance with state and federal regulations and regional guidelines.
  • May perform patient care to the extent necessary to maintain clinical expertise, competency, and licensing necessary to fulfill job responsibilities and to direct the provision of care on the unit.
  • Provides direct patient care. Provides services that are within scope of license and in compliance with all legal, regulatory, and policy requirements relevant to clinical role performed.
  • Incorporates the KP Nursing Vision, Model and Values throughout their Nursing Practice.

Basic Qualifications:

Experience


  • Minimum two (2) years experience in mental health managing patients on psychiatric medications.

  • Minimum two (2) years experience in mental health providing direct clinical services with children and/or adults, including people with serious/chronic mental illness.

Education


  • Masters degree in Nursing with specialty in community mental health, behavioral health, psychiatric nursing, or related field.

License, Certification, Registration


  • Psychiatric-Mental Health Clinical Nurse Specialist Certification OR Psychiatric-Mental Health Nurse Practitioner Certification


  • Advanced Practice Registered Nurse License with Prescriptive Authority (Hawaii)


  • Registered Nurse License (Hawaii) required at hire


  • National Provider Identifier


  • Basic Life Support from American Heart Association

Additional Requirements:


  • Demonstrated knowledge of assessment using the latest Diagnostic and Statistical Manual (DSM) and International Statistical Classification of Disease and Related Health Problems (ICD), writing treatment plans, including medication management for patients with behavioral health conditions.

  • Demonstrated knowledge and/or experience of working in an integrated behavioral health model within a primary care setting.

  • Taxonomy code required at time of hire.

Preferred Qualifications:


  • Demonstrated knowledge of documentation according to national accreditation guidelines.
